How To Get a Medical Marijuana Card in Christiana
TN – A marijuana card, or MedCard is a state issued ID card that allows qualified patients access to medical cannabis in accord with state laws. Currently there is not a path to legalized fully loaded medical cannabis in Christiana. Unlike most of the United States, Tennessee remains frozen in progress of this evolution in modern medicine taking place.
SB 280 – The state law allows for High CBD Low THC cannabis oil for seizure patients inline with SB 280. The bill does not address how patients can obtain the cannabis based CBD oil as it is not produced in Tennessee and crossing state lines would constitute a violation of both State and Federal laws. What it did address is if a patient is caught with oil by Law Enforcement the patient must produce an authorization from a doctor and proof of where the CBD oil was purchased.

What is the difference between CBD & THC?
- Psychoactive Vs. Non-Psychoactive. THC creates a euphoric effect due to the way it connects to the bodies endocannabinoid system. The endocannabinoid system has been recently recognized as an important modulatory system in the function of brain, endocrine, and immune tissues. Cannabidiol, or CBD reacts differently and is used with patients that require or prefer non euphoric care.
